Navigating Tooth Restorations: Crowns, Bridges and Implants Explained

A healthy smile depends on more than regular brushing and flossing. Teeth may become damaged or lost due to decay, injury, wear, or other oral health conditions. Fortunately, several restorative dental treatment options are available to help restore function and appearance. Understanding the differences between crowns, bridges, and dental implants may help you have a more informed discussion with your dental team about your individual treatment needs.

What Is a Dental Crown?

A dental crown is a custom-made restoration that covers the visible portion of a tooth. It may be recommended when a tooth has been weakened by extensive decay, has a large filling, has fractured, or has received root canal treatment.

The purpose of a crown is to restore the tooth’s shape, strength, and function while helping protect the remaining natural tooth structure. Crowns are designed to blend with surrounding teeth whenever possible, creating a natural appearance.

Your dentist will determine whether a crown is an appropriate option based on your oral health and the condition of the affected tooth.

When Is a Dental Bridge Used?

A dental bridge is commonly used to replace one or more missing teeth when suitable neighbouring teeth are available for support.

A bridge consists of one or more artificial teeth that are anchored by crowns placed on adjacent teeth. Replacing missing teeth may help restore chewing function, maintain spacing between teeth, and support overall oral function.

Not every patient is a candidate for a bridge. Your dentist will assess your oral health, remaining teeth, and supporting bone before recommending the most suitable treatment option.

Understanding Dental Implants

Dental implants are another option for replacing missing teeth. An implant consists of a titanium post that is surgically placed into the jawbone, where it serves as a foundation for a replacement tooth after appropriate healing.

Dental implants may be considered for replacing a single tooth, several teeth, or, in some situations, to support other restorative options. However, eligibility depends on several factors, including overall oral health, bone quantity, medical history, and individual treatment goals.

Your dentist will explain whether dental implants are appropriate for your specific circumstances after completing a thorough examination.

Which Restoration Is Right for You?

There is no single restorative solution that is appropriate for every patient. Treatment recommendations depend on several considerations, including:

  • The condition of your remaining teeth
  • The location of the missing or damaged tooth
  • Gum and bone health
  • Oral hygiene habits
  • Overall health history
  • Individual treatment preferences

A personalized assessment allows your dentist to discuss available options, expected procedures, and maintenance requirements before treatment begins.
